<h3>What was Micheal Lee Aim?</h3>
The aim of the study is to see the ways that different cultures value in terms of lying/morality and the understanding of these ideas.
<h3>What was Micheal Lee Sample?</h3>
He was known to have used 120 Chinese children and 108 Canadian children who were known to be between 7 and 11 years old.
In the study, Half of each cultural group were said to be assign either to a physical story group or a social story group.
